Transaction ee39de61aa5887ca3a7fa319d9051da20973315a660997255faa0c3835e3fca5
1 Input
1 Output
-
ee39de61aa5887ca3a7fa319d9051da20973315a660997255faa0c3835e3fca5:0
- value
- 98286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d862c96da3abb8ce0653158208eba3866f31ed8 OP_EQUAL
- address
- 35qj4m7UzrYuEtnxsbHCTnnMdsw7AeTqii